- (xDir: Image<Gray, float>)
- (yDir: Image<Gray, float>)
- (radiusRange: float * float)
- (windowSize: int)
- (factorNbPick: float) : Types.Ellipse list =
+ (xGradient: Image<Gray, float>)
+ (yGradient: Image<Gray, float>)
+ (config: Config) : MatchingEllipses =
+
+ let r1, r2 = config.RBCMinRadius, config.RBCMaxRadius
+ let windowSize = roundInt (config.Parameters.factorWindowSize * r2)
+ let factorNbPick = config.Parameters.factorNbPick